7.4.9 Hydraulically connecting the axial piston unit
NOTICE
Insufficient suction pressure!
Generally, a minimum permissible suction pressure at port S is specified for axial
piston pumps in all installation positions. If the pressure at port S drops below the
specified values, damage may occur which may lead to the axial piston pump being
damaged beyond repair.
▶ Make sure that the necessary suction pressure is met at all times. This is
influenced by:
– The piping (for example, suction cross-section, pipe diameter, length of
suction line)
– The position of the reservoir
– The viscosity of the hydraulic fluid
– Any filter element or check valve in the suction line (regularly check the filter
element’s level of contamination)
The machine/system manufacturer is responsible for sizing the lines. Connect the
axial piston unit to the rest of the hydraulic system in accordance with the hydraulic
circuit diagram of the machine/system manufacturer.
The ports and fastening threads are designed for the maximum permissible
pressures p
max
, see Table 11 “Ports of A10VO, A10VSO and A10VSNO Series 32” on
page 38. The machine/system manufacturer should make sure the connecting
elements and lines correspond to the specified application conditions (pressure,
flow, hydraulic fluid, temperature) with the necessary safety factors.
Connect only hydraulic lines that are match the axial piston unit port (pressure
level, size, system of units).
Observe the following information when routing the suction, pressure and drain
lines.
• Lines and hoses should be installed without pre-charge pressure so no further
mechanical forces are applied during operation that will reduce the service life of
the axial piston unit and, possibly, the entire machine/system.
• Use suitable seals as sealing material.
• Suction line (pipe or hose)
– The suction line should be as short and straight as possible.
